Hels Posted July 25, 2005 Share Posted July 25, 2005 Ka-China at Waleswoood (used to be the Waleswood pub) is brilliant. It changed to a chinese restaurant soon after the pub closed and wasn't very nice at first. I think they have new owners now and it's been totally refurbished. The menu is extensive and the staff are lovely and friendly. You'll need to book for Friday or Saturday nights though. It's out of Sheffield (Waleswood is right next to Wales) and close to Rother Valley so it's a bit out of the way if you don't live that side of town, but it's well worth the trip.
